What Is a Partial Hospitalization Program?
A partial hospitalization program represents a structured level of care that provides intensive therapeutic support without requiring overnight stays. Clients typically attend programming five to six days per week for five to eight hours daily, receiving comprehensive treatment during the day while returning home or to sober living each evening. PHP serves as an essential step-down care in the addiction treatment continuum, positioned strategically between residential treatment and less intensive outpatient programs.
How PHP Fits Into the Treatment Continuum
The addiction treatment continuum recognizes that recovery requires different levels of support at different stages. At Restore Health & Wellness Center, we believe in meeting you exactly where you are:
Medical Detox: The foundation where physical stabilization occurs under medical supervision
Residential Treatment: Immersive 24/7 care addressing the psychological, emotional, and behavioral aspects of addiction
Partial Hospitalization Program: Intensive daytime programming with evening independence
Intensive Outpatient Program (IOP): Reduced hours allowing return to work or school
Outpatient Treatment: Ongoing maintenance support with weekly sessions

Who Benefits Most from PHP?
Partial Hospitalization Programs serve individuals who need substantial support but have achieved sufficient stability for increased independence. You might benefit from PHP if you:
- Are completing residential treatment but aren’t quite ready for outpatient care alone
- Have a supportive home environment or live in a sober living community
- Want to balance recovery with family reconnection or gradual work reintegration
- Require intensive dual diagnosis treatment outside a residential setting
- Have experienced setbacks with outpatient programs and need increased structure and support

FAQ
How long does a Partial Hospitalization Program last?
PHP typically lasts two to four weeks, though duration varies based on your individual progress and clinical needs. We adjust your treatment plan as you grow stronger in your recovery.
Can I work while attending PHP?
The intensive schedule (5-8 hours daily) makes full-time employment challenging during this phase, but evening and weekend hours remain available for personal responsibilities and gradual reintegration.

What’s the difference between PHP and IOP?
PHP requires 5-8 hours daily, while IOP typically involves 9-12 hours weekly spread across several days, allowing greater work and school participation.
